当前位置:首页 > 科技 > 正文

数据库复制模式与数据冗余:构建高效数据管理的双面镜

  • 科技
  • 2025-09-06 08:25:54
  • 3960
摘要: 在当今数字化时代,数据已成为企业决策的基石。然而,如何确保数据的高效管理与安全传输,成为了众多企业面临的挑战。数据库复制模式与数据冗余作为数据管理中的两大关键概念,它们如同双面镜,一面映射出数据传输的高效性,另一面则揭示了数据安全的多重保障。本文将深入探讨...

在当今数字化时代,数据已成为企业决策的基石。然而,如何确保数据的高效管理与安全传输,成为了众多企业面临的挑战。数据库复制模式与数据冗余作为数据管理中的两大关键概念,它们如同双面镜,一面映射出数据传输的高效性,另一面则揭示了数据安全的多重保障。本文将深入探讨这两者之间的关联,以及它们如何共同构建起企业数据管理的坚实基础。

# 一、数据库复制模式:数据传输的高效桥梁

数据库复制模式是指将数据从一个数据库复制到另一个数据库的过程。这一过程不仅能够实现数据的快速传输,还能确保数据在多个节点之间的同步更新。数据库复制模式主要包括主从复制、对等复制和分布式复制三种类型。

1. 主从复制:这是最常见的数据库复制模式之一。在这种模式下,一个数据库作为主数据库,负责接收所有写操作,并将这些操作同步到一个或多个从数据库。主从复制模式适用于需要高可用性和读写分离的应用场景,如电商网站、在线支付系统等。

2. 对等复制:对等复制模式中,所有节点之间可以相互复制数据。这种模式适用于分布式系统,如区块链技术中的节点间数据同步。对等复制能够确保数据在所有节点之间的一致性,但同时也带来了较高的网络开销和复杂性。

3. 分布式复制:分布式复制模式结合了主从复制和对等复制的优点,适用于大规模分布式系统。在这种模式下,数据被分割成多个部分,并在多个节点之间进行复制。分布式复制能够实现高可用性和负载均衡,但同时也需要复杂的管理和维护。

# 二、数据冗余:构建数据安全的多重保障

数据库复制模式与数据冗余:构建高效数据管理的双面镜

数据冗余是指在多个位置存储相同或相似的数据副本,以确保数据的可靠性和可用性。数据冗余是数据库复制模式的重要补充,它能够提高数据的容错能力和恢复速度。常见的数据冗余策略包括物理冗余和逻辑冗余。

1. 物理冗余:物理冗余是指在不同的物理位置存储相同的数据副本。这种冗余策略能够确保即使某个存储节点发生故障,数据仍然能够被其他节点访问。物理冗余通常通过RAID技术实现,如RAID 1、RAID 5和RAID 10等。

数据库复制模式与数据冗余:构建高效数据管理的双面镜

2. 逻辑冗余:逻辑冗余是指在不同的逻辑位置存储相同的数据副本。这种冗余策略能够确保即使某个逻辑节点发生故障,数据仍然能够被其他节点访问。逻辑冗余通常通过数据库复制模式实现,如主从复制和对等复制。

# 三、数据库复制模式与数据冗余的关联

数据库复制模式与数据冗余:构建高效数据管理的双面镜

数据库复制模式与数据冗余之间的关联主要体现在以下几个方面:

1. 提高数据可用性:通过数据库复制模式和数据冗余策略的结合,可以确保数据在多个节点之间的一致性和可用性。即使某个节点发生故障,其他节点仍然能够提供数据服务,从而提高了系统的整体可用性。

数据库复制模式与数据冗余:构建高效数据管理的双面镜

2. 增强数据安全性:数据冗余策略能够确保即使某个存储节点发生故障,数据仍然能够被其他节点访问。而数据库复制模式则能够确保数据在多个节点之间的同步更新,从而增强了数据的安全性。

3. 优化数据传输效率:数据库复制模式能够实现数据的快速传输和同步更新,而数据冗余策略则能够确保数据在多个节点之间的可靠性和一致性。通过这两种策略的结合,可以实现高效的数据传输和优化的数据管理。

数据库复制模式与数据冗余:构建高效数据管理的双面镜

# 四、案例分析:如何在实际应用中运用数据库复制模式与数据冗余

以电商网站为例,该网站需要处理大量的在线交易和用户访问请求。为了确保系统的高可用性和读写分离,可以采用主从复制模式。主数据库负责接收所有写操作,并将这些操作同步到多个从数据库。同时,为了提高系统的容错能力和恢复速度,可以采用物理冗余策略,如RAID 1或RAID 5,确保即使某个存储节点发生故障,数据仍然能够被其他节点访问。

数据库复制模式与数据冗余:构建高效数据管理的双面镜

# 五、结论:构建高效数据管理的坚实基础

数据库复制模式与数据冗余是构建高效数据管理的坚实基础。通过合理运用这两种策略,可以实现数据的高效传输、可靠存储和快速恢复。在实际应用中,企业需要根据自身的业务需求和技术条件,选择合适的数据库复制模式和数据冗余策略,从而构建起高效、可靠和安全的数据管理系统。

数据库复制模式与数据冗余:构建高效数据管理的双面镜

总之,数据库复制模式与数据冗余如同双面镜,一面映射出数据传输的高效性,另一面则揭示了数据安全的多重保障。通过合理运用这两种策略,企业可以构建起高效、可靠和安全的数据管理系统,从而在数字化时代中立于不败之地。